    The problem of completeness of exponential polynomials in subspaces of analytic functions invariant with respect to the operator of multiple differentiation is transferred to the similar problem for the operator of componentwise differentiation in some spaces of vector-valued functions. The author constructs some examples which give the negative answer to some questions about spectral theory of ordinary differential operators in complex domain formulated by \textit{V. A. Tkachenko} in the volume ''99 unsolved problems of linear and complex analysis'', LOMI, 1978 (see problem 6.5).
